The ingredients needed to make Perogies with Kielbasa and Onion:
  1. Make ready 3 c flour plus more for rolling dough
  2. Prepare 3 eggs
  3. Prepare 16 oz sour cream, divided
  4. Prepare 3 tsp baking powder
  5. Take 1/2 tsp salt
  6. Make ready 5-6 medium potatoes, peeled and chpped
  7. Make ready 2 medium onions, chopped and divided
  8. Get 2 tbsp minced garlic
  9. Prepare 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
  10. Prepare 1 stick butter
  11. Take 1 Polish kielbasa
  12. Prepare 1/2 tsp pepper
  13. Prepare 1/4 tsp seasoning salt
  14. Make ready 1/2 tsp garlic powder

Steps to make Perogies with Kielbasa and Onion:
  1. First, start preparing filling: - *boil potatoes until soft - *saute 1/3 of the onion, garlic, and salt and pepper to taste in about 2 tbsp butter
  2. Prepare dough: - Combine flour, baking powder, and 1/2 tsp salt. Make a well in the middle and fill with half of sour cream and eggs. Combine well and turn out on a floured board. Knead until smooth.
  3. Combine softened potatoes and sauteed onion mix with the remaining half of the sour cream and cheese. This should be the consistency of mashed potatoes.
  4. Roll out dough until about 1/4 inch thick. Using a round cookie cutter or the open end of a large mouth glass, cut circles out of the dough. Continue until all dough is used.
  5. To put together perogies, place about 1 tbsp of potato mixture in the middle of a dough circle. Fold dough circle in half into a half circle shape. Pinch edges together well so that potato mixture will not come out.
  6. Cook perogies: - *boil a large pot of water. Drop perogies into boiling water one at a time. Boil about 10 minutes. - *melt butter in the bottom of a large frying pan. Using a slotted spoon, remove perogies from water and sautee in butter for a few minutes on each side or until each side is browned. - *place perogies on a baking sheet in the oven on the lowest heat setting to keep warm.
  7. Cook kielbasa and onion: - *slice kielbasa at an angle inton1/2 inch pieces. - *combine onion, 2 tbsp butter, season salt, pepper, and garlic powder. Sautee for 3-5 minutes - *add kielbasa to onion mixture and cook through
  8. Place desired amout of perogies on your plate and top with Kielbasa mixture. Enjoy!
  9. You can substitute sauerkraut for the onion in the kielbasa mixture if you desire. My husband doesn't like sauerkraut son onions work better for our family
